Finance Review Summary — Board

Quick read on the Merrowby product line: pricing held up better than expected this quarter. Average realized price rose 4%, discount leakage dropped, and margin on the mid-tier SKUs is back above target. The entry-level tier is still thin, frankly. We recommend a structured repricing in Q1. The confidential plan underpinning that recommendation is set out below.

board note of bahif-yajef: Only 9 of the 120 pilot accounts renewed Oliwyn, so a churn review is set for January 1.

MEMO — Branch Managers

Re: Second-source supplier search. Procurement is qualifying alternatives to Harnell Components for valve assemblies. Two candidates, Ostrid Works and Felmark Precision, enter trials next month. Branches should flag any Harnell delivery slips immediately — data feeds the decision. No changes to ordering procedures yet. Expect a final recommendation by end of quarter. The confidential planning note appears below.

board note of fafog-yahap: Project Rusdor slips by a full year because of the audit delay.

☐ Turnstile counter reseal — Gatewick Arena. After the quarterly key ceremony, verify the TallyGate counter module at the north concourse reports zero drift against the steward logbook. Re-enable the signed firmware lock before leaving the vault room. Future maintainers should note the counter's sealed config cannot be regenerated; it can only be restored with the passphrase below.

unlock words, yadup-yagef: zorael-druix

Ticket: Staging env misconfigured for Siftgate bloom filter

The bloom layer in front of the Pellet KV store is rejecting all lookups in staging because the env file was copied from the dev template without credentials. False-positive tuning values are fine; only the auth line is missing. To unblock the weekly demo, the Pellet admission secret must be set on the following line.

env line for yaguf-fajop: LEDGER_TOKEN13=fb08984397349